Understanding Facebook's Support System

Before we delve into the specifics of accessing live chat, it's crucial to understand the landscape of Facebook's support system. Facebook primarily relies on a comprehensive help center, which is filled with articles, FAQs, and troubleshooting guides designed to address a wide array of issues. This self-service approach aims to empower users to find solutions independently. However, for more complex or unique problems, navigating this system can be frustrating, leading users to seek more direct forms of support. The availability of live chat support varies depending on several factors, including the nature of your issue, your account status, and whether you're an advertiser. Facebook tends to prioritize live chat support for advertisers who spend a significant amount on the platform, as their issues directly impact Facebook's revenue. For regular users, accessing live chat can be more challenging but not entirely impossible. Understanding this framework is the first step in effectively seeking the support you need.

Methods to Potentially Access Facebook Live Chat

While there's no guaranteed way to access Facebook live chat, here are several avenues you can explore:

  1. Facebook Business Support: If you manage a Facebook Business Page or run ads on the platform, you might have access to live chat support through the Facebook Business Help Center. To check, visit the Business Help Center, select your business account, and look for a "Chat with a representative" option. This option is typically available during business hours and may require you to provide detailed information about your issue.

  2. Ads Manager Support: For issues related to advertising, the Ads Manager interface sometimes offers a live chat option. Navigate to the Ads Manager, click on the question mark icon to access the help menu, and see if a chat option is available. Keep in mind that this option is more likely to appear if you are a regular advertiser with a substantial ad spend.

  3. Report a Problem: Facebook's "Report a Problem" feature, found within the help center, allows you to describe your issue in detail. While this doesn't directly connect you to a live chat, it can sometimes lead to a follow-up from a support agent who may offer to chat with you in real-time.

  4. Contacting Facebook through other channels: Although not live chat, consider reaching out through other available channels, such as email or social media. While response times may vary, providing detailed information about your issue can help expedite the process and potentially lead to a more direct form of communication.

Step-by-Step Guide to Finding Live Chat (If Available)

Let's walk through the steps you can take to try and find the live chat option within Facebook's support system:

  1. Go to the Facebook Help Center: Start by navigating to the Facebook Help Center. You can find it by clicking the question mark icon in the top right corner of your Facebook page and selecting "Help & Support."

  2. Search for Your Issue: Use the search bar to type in the specific issue you're experiencing. Browse through the suggested articles and FAQs to see if your problem can be resolved through self-service.

  3. Look for Contact Options: If the articles don't provide a solution, look for a "Contact Us" or "Get Support" button. These options may lead you to a form where you can describe your issue in more detail.

  4. Check for Live Chat: After submitting your issue, keep an eye out for a live chat option. It may appear as a pop-up window or a button that says "Chat with a representative." If you see this option, click on it to start a live chat session.

  5. Be Prepared to Provide Information: When you initiate a live chat, be prepared to provide detailed information about your issue, including screenshots, account details, and any relevant information that can help the support agent understand your problem.
